Expressed Breast Milk Contamination in Neonatal Intensive Care Unit.

Suzan GadMohamed M ShetaAbeer I Al-KhalafawiHeba A Abu El-FadlMaha AnanyShaimaa SahmoudMona Karem Amin
Published in: Pediatric health, medicine and therapeutics (2021)
The present study identified bacterial contamination in about 90% of EBM samples delivered to NICU infants. Factors related to EBM contamination include hygienic, storage and transport factors.
